The Bail Bond Agreement is a legal document utilized when a person, referred to as the Applicant, seeks to post bail or bond with no conditions on behalf of a Defendant in Salt Lake. This document formalizes the arrangement between the Applicant and a Bail Bonding Company (BBC), detailing the premium payment and indemnification terms against liabilities incurred by the BBC or the Surety. Key features of this form include instructions for payment of the bond premium, reusable indemnification clauses, and obligations to cooperate in case of the Defendant's surrender. Bail Eligibility in Utah Any person who has been charged with a non-capital crime is entitled, in most situations, to bail. Capital crimes are those crimes punishable by death. Most states that have a bail system have their own laws that may impact eligibility.

You need to file a motion to amend bond conditions with the court. You should at least consult with a local criminal defense attorney (if you are not already represented by someone) to discuss the issues the court will consider, and the best way to address those issues.

The defendant can post their own bail or ask a family member or friend to post it. If the defendant uses a bond company, the company may require the defendant to have a co-signer (someone who will help the company find the defendant should they fail to appear).
